Output 53d3a3abbc6d450fad3bb84b7d75a89abb5eedad1c26bb43b3f00a3ef21db9bf:13

value
1040948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29497bd20e739e46f0137ca8216f111cb23204c5 OP_EQUAL
address
35TKf9JbKQYirqYUyWp33gJYnCTjqu3CnE
transaction
53d3a3abbc6d450fad3bb84b7d75a89abb5eedad1c26bb43b3f00a3ef21db9bf
confirmations
375282
spent
true